Quick Facts
Enrollment: 75 ( 75 undergraduate)
Type: Private for-profit, less-than 2-year

 

Admissions Total Male Female
Number of applicants 91 42 49
Percent admitted 100% 100% 100%
Percent admitted who enrolled 100% 100% 100%

Financial Aid

Percentage of students receiving any financial aid 76%
Percentage of students receiving Federal Grants 76%
Average Federal Grant $1,466.00
Percentage of students receiving state aid 0%
Average state aid $0.00
Percentage of students receiving institutional aid 35%
Average institutional aid $980.00
Percentage of students receiving a student loan 76%
Average student loan $3,571.00

Degrees:

Less than one year certificate

Majors:
Computer/Info Tech Services Administration & Management, Other
Medical Insurance Coding Specialist/Coder
Pharmacy Technician/Assistant
